The slope of the line below is 4. Which of the following is the point-slope form

of the line?

(-3,-4)
A. y+ 4 = 4(x+3)
B. Y-4 =-4(x-3)
C. y-4= 4(x-3)
D. Y+4 = -4(X+3)​

Answer:

A: y+4=4(x+3)

Explanation:

Point-Slope Formula:

y-y1=m(x-x1)

Substitute:

y-(-4)=4(x-(-3))

-(-)=+

P: y+4=4(x+3)
